Voltage reference generator and a method for controlling a magnitude of a variation of an output voltage of a voltage reference generator
Abstract:
A voltage reference generator comprises a voltage reference, a variable gain amplifier connected to an output terminal of the voltage reference, a sampling capacitor connected to an output terminal of the voltage reference generator and to an output terminal of the variable gain amplifier via a sampling switch. The switch is adapted to close during a first portion of a switching period, and open during a second portion of the switching period. The voltage reference generator also comprises a ripple monitor adapted to estimate a magnitude of variation of an output voltage of the voltage reference generator resulting from charging and discharging of the sampling capacitor, and based on the estimate, perform one of control of the sampling switch to reduce a switching frequency of the sampling switch to increase a magnitude of the variation of the output voltage, and control of the sampling switch to increase the switching frequency.
